About This Book

The treatment center had a real name but everybody who went there called it Malady Manor. It was the kind of place where medicine, insurance coverage, and addiction meet to argue. For one disgraced lawyer it is a second chance at life. He had barely survived his alcoholism and now has to survive recovery. Malady Manor is the story of how a cynical, atheist, ex-lawyer makes it through the sense and nonsense of addiction treatment. Desperate for answers, yet highly skeptical that they can be found where he is, he slogs his way through the program, the counselors and the psychobabble. His oasis in the recovery desert is other addicts; people just a screwed up as he is. The story is both his own and the story of every person who has found him or herself facing the ceiling at night from the lumpy mattress of residential drug and alcohol treatment. If you are going there, or have been there, or simply want an evening of fun learning what it is like, Malady Manor is for you.
